1. Filling in Sparse Brows

If you have sparse brows, filling them in with powder can give you a fuller, more defined look. Begin by choosing a powder shade that matches your natural brow color. Then, using a small angled brush, gently apply the powder to your brows in short, light strokes. This technique allows you to gradually build up the intensity until you achieve your desired shape and fullness.

For a more natural and long-lasting result, consider using a brow powder that is waterproof or smudge-proof. These formulas are designed to withstand sweat and humidity, ensuring your brows stay perfect all day long. Prices for brow powders can vary, with average prices ranging from $10 to $25, depending on the brand and quality.

Remember to brush through your brows with a spoolie brush after applying the powder to blend it seamlessly with your natural hairs.

2. Shaping Your Brows

Creating the perfect brow shape is essential for enhancing your overall facial structure. Powder can be a great tool to help you achieve that symmetrical and well-defined shape.

Start by using a brow pencil to outline the desired shape of your brows. Then, using an angled brush, fill in the outline with brow powder that matches your natural hair color. The powder will give you a softer, more diffused look compared to a pencil, making your brows appear more natural.

Remember to blend the powder well with a spoolie brush to avoid any harsh lines or inconsistencies. Additionally, setting your newly shaped brows with a clear brow gel will ensure they stay in place throughout the day.

3. Fixing Overplucked Brows

If you have fallen victim to overplucking and ended up with thin or uneven brows, don't worry! Brow powders can come to the rescue and help you achieve a fuller, more balanced look.

Start by brushing your brows upward with a spoolie brush to identify any sparse areas. Then, using a small angled brush, gently apply the powder to those areas, focusing on creating natural-looking hair-like strokes. Remember to build up the intensity gradually to avoid a heavy or unnatural appearance.

To make your brows look even more natural, use a brow pencil to draw small, fine strokes that mimic the appearance of real hair. This combination of powder and pencil will help fill in the gaps and give your brows a natural and fuller look.

4. Darkening Light Brows

If you have light or fair brows and wish to darken them, powder can be a great option. Choose a powder shade that is a few shades darker than your natural brow color to create a subtle yet noticeable change.

Using an angled brush, apply the powder to your brows in light, short strokes, gradually building up the color until you achieve the desired darkness. Remember to focus on the mid to outer parts of your brows, as this will create a more natural gradient effect.

To prevent your newly darkened brows from looking too harsh or unnatural, use a spoolie brush to blend the powder and soften any harsh lines. The result will be defined, yet natural-looking, darkened brows that beautifully frame your face.

5. Quick Touch-Ups

One of the greatest benefits of using brow powder is the ability to do quick touch-ups on the go. Whether you're at work, traveling, or out for an evening, a mini brow powder kit can be your best friend.

Investing in a travel-sized brow powder compact with a mirror and a small angled brush allows you to fix and refresh your brows in a matter of minutes. Instead of carrying multiple products, simply use the brush to apply the powder and blend it with a spoolie brush for a quick touch-up that will instantly elevate your look.

These travel-sized brow powder kits can range from $15 to $30, depending on the brand and included accessories.

6. Creating a Gradient Effect

A gradient effect can add depth and dimension to your brows, making them appear fuller and more natural. Using two shades of brow powder can help you achieve this effect effortlessly.

Start by applying the lighter shade to the inner part of your brows and the arch. This will create a soft and natural-looking start to your brow shape. Then, using the darker shade, apply it to the outer part of your brows and blend it towards the center. This creates a gradual transition from lighter to darker, giving your brows a more three-dimensional appearance.

Remember to blend the two shades together with a spoolie brush to achieve a seamless effect. This technique is perfect for those who want to add some extra oomph to their brows while maintaining a natural look.

7. Using Powder as a Brow Setter

Aside from filling in and shaping your brows, powder can also be used as a brow setter to keep your hairs in place throughout the day.

After applying your desired amount of brow powder, lightly dust a translucent powder or a setting powder over your brows. Use a small, fluffy brush to sweep away any excess product and ensure your brows stay put.

This hack is especially useful for those with unruly brows or in hot and humid climates. It helps maintain the shape and appearance of your brows, preventing them from smudging or losing their shape throughout the day.

8. Softening Harsh Brow Look

If you've applied too much brow product and ended up with a harsh or blocky look, fret not! Powder can help soften the appearance and create a more natural finish.

Using a clean spoolie brush, simply brush through your brows to soften the powder and create a more diffused effect. The brush will blend the product with your natural brow hairs, making the overall look appear softer and more natural.

This technique is great for fixing any mistakes or achieving a more undone, natural brow look. Plus, it's an easy and quick solution to transform your brows from harsh to soft in no time.

Common Questions:

1. Should I always use a brow powder to enhance my eyebrows?

While brow powders are a popular choice, there are other options such as pencils, gels, or pomades available. The choice depends on your personal preference and the desired effect you want to achieve.

2. Can I use eyeshadow as a substitute for brow powder?

In a pinch, you can use eyeshadow as a temporary substitute for brow powder. Just ensure that the eyeshadow shade matches your natural brow color, and use a light hand to apply it.

3. How do I choose the right shade of brow powder?

To choose the right shade of brow powder, opt for a shade that closely matches your natural brow color. If in doubt, go for a slightly lighter shade rather than a darker one, as it's easier to build up the intensity than to lighten an overly dark shade.

4. Can I use brow powder on thinning eyebrows?

Yes, brow powder can be used to fill in thinning eyebrows. The powder can create the illusion of fuller brows by adding color and volume to sparse areas.

5. How often will I need to touch up my brows when using powder?

The longevity of your brow powder will depend on the formula and your skin type. However, it's generally recommended to touch up your brows throughout the day, especially if you have oily or combination skin.
